Square Feet to Cubic Yards: Formula and Methodology
Converting a two-dimensional area measurement in square feet to a three-dimensional volume in cubic yards requires knowing both the surface area and the material depth. This ft2 yd3 converter applies a foundational volumetric formula used daily by engineers, contractors, and quantity estimators on projects ranging from residential driveways to highway subbase construction.
The Core Formula
The standard conversion formula is:
V (yd³) = [A (ft²) × D (ft)] ÷ 27
Where each variable represents:
- V = Volume in cubic yards (yd³) — the final output used to order bulk materials
- A = Area in square feet (ft²) — the two-dimensional footprint of the surface
- D = Depth or thickness in feet (ft) — how deep the material will be placed
- 27 = The number of cubic feet contained in exactly one cubic yard
Why Divide by 27?
One linear yard equals exactly 3 feet. A cubic yard is therefore a perfect cube measuring 3 feet on every edge: 3 ft × 3 ft × 3 ft = 27 cubic feet. As established in the Tennessee Department of Environment and Conservation Water Treatment Mathematical Formulas — Unit Conversions, dividing any volume expressed in cubic feet by 27 converts it directly to cubic yards. This relationship is absolute and applies universally to all bulk material calculations. The Indiana Department of Transportation Chapter 17 — Quantity Estimating confirms this factor as the standard divisor for all earthwork and material volume conversions in construction quantity takeoffs.
Step-by-Step Derivation
- Step 1 — Compute cubic feet: Multiply the area in square feet by the depth in feet: V (ft³) = A (ft²) × D (ft). This intermediate step produces the raw volume in cubic feet.
- Step 2 — Convert to cubic yards: Divide the cubic foot result by 27: V (yd³) = V (ft³) ÷ 27. Suppliers quote bulk material prices per cubic yard, making this the final actionable unit.
- Step 3 — Handle depth unit conversions: If depth is given in inches, divide by 12 first to get feet (e.g., 4 inches ÷ 12 = 0.333 ft). If given in centimeters, multiply by 0.0328 to convert to feet before applying the formula.
Practical Construction Use Cases
The ft2 yd3 converter is applied across multiple construction and landscaping disciplines. Real-world examples demonstrate the formula in action:
- Concrete slabs and driveways: A 400 ft² driveway poured at 4 inches (0.333 ft) deep requires (400 × 0.333) ÷ 27 ≈ 4.93 yd³ of concrete — round up to 5 yd³ when ordering from a ready-mix supplier.
- Mulch and topsoil: Covering a 500 ft² garden bed at 3 inches (0.25 ft) deep requires (500 × 0.25) ÷ 27 ≈ 4.63 yd³ of organic material.
- Gravel base layers: A 1,200 ft² road subbase at 6 inches (0.5 ft) deep requires (1,200 × 0.5) ÷ 27 ≈ 22.2 yd³ of crushed aggregate.
- Sand for paver installations: Setting 800 ft² of pavers on a 1-inch (0.083 ft) bedding layer takes (800 × 0.083) ÷ 27 ≈ 2.46 yd³ of coarse sand.
- Fill dirt for site grading: Filling a 2,000 ft² excavation to a uniform depth of 1 foot requires (2,000 × 1) ÷ 27 ≈ 74.1 yd³ of fill material.
Rounding and Over-Ordering Best Practices
Construction professionals routinely add 5–15% to their calculated volume before placing a material order. This buffer accounts for material compaction, spillage during delivery, and irregularities in the subgrade surface. For concrete specifically, rounding up to the nearest quarter cubic yard prevents costly return trips from the batch plant. Loose materials like topsoil and mulch settle 10–20% after placement, so the overage factor is especially important for achieving the target finished depth.
Unit Conversion Quick Reference
- 1 cubic yard = 27 cubic feet
- 1 cubic yard = 46,656 cubic inches
- 1 cubic yard ≈ 0.7646 cubic meters
- 1 inch of depth = 0.0833 feet
- 1 centimeter of depth ≈ 0.0328 feet
